WebMar 18, 2002 · Smith, Dennis Edward was born on September 9, 1940 in New York City. Son of John and Mary (Hogan) Smith. Education Bachelor, New York University, 1970. Master of Arts, New York University, 1972. Career Adjunct assistan professor College New Rochelle, 1973-1974. Fireman City of New York, 1963-1980.

Dennis Smith (September 9, 1940 – January 21, 2024) was an American firefighter and author. He was the author of 16 books, the most notable of which is the memoir Report from Engine Co. 82, a chronicle of his career as a firefighter with the New York City Fire Department in a South Bronx … See more According to his autobiography, Dennis Smith is of Irish ancestry and grew up in a tenement on the East Side of Manhattan.
